Frequently Asked Questions

What historical landmarks can I explore in Mazcuerras?

Mazcuerras is rich in historical architecture. You can visit the 17th-century Iglesia de San Martín, the Baroque Casa Palacio Gutiérrez de Mier, or the significant Casa de Concha Espina, home of the acclaimed writer. Don't miss the Palacio de Las Magnolias, an eclectic-style palace, and various traditional Casonas Montañesas and Casas Llanas, including the 15th-century Casa Gótica.

Are there any cultural sites or unique points of interest in Mazcuerras?

Yes, Mazcuerras offers several cultural points. You can see the Escultura a Concha Espina and visit the Plaza de Concha Espina. Experience the local tradition of Bolos Cántabros at the Manolo Escalante bowling alley. The town also features an antique Arado Brabant plow and hosts ASLEART, an open-air rural art exhibition during July and August.

What natural features can I enjoy around Mazcuerras?

The Río Saja and its tributary, the Pulero stream, are central to Mazcuerras's natural beauty, offering picturesque settings. You can also explore Parque "El Bosque", which includes a former public wash house, or walk along the Senda Fluvial del Minchón, a scenic trail along the Saja River.

Are there any notable religious buildings to visit?

Absolutely. Besides the local Iglesia de San Martín, you can visit the San Pedro Church of Oreña, which offers spectacular views of the Picos de Europa. Another significant site is the Collegiate Church of Santa Juliana (Colegiata de Santa Juliana), a remarkable 12th-century monastery with detailed cloister capitals. Further afield, the Cistercian Abbey of Saint Mary, Cóbreces, a neo-Gothic Trappist monastery, is also worth seeing.

What is the best time to visit Mazcuerras to enjoy its attractions?

Mazcuerras is charming throughout the year, but the warmer months, particularly late spring to early autumn (May to October), are ideal for enjoying outdoor activities and the town's floral displays. The ASLEART open-air art exhibition takes place during July and August, adding a cultural highlight to summer visits.

Where can I find traditional Cantabrian architecture?

Mazcuerras is an excellent place to see traditional Cantabrian architecture. The town features numerous 18th-century casonas montañesas and older, single-story casas llanas, some dating back to the 16th century. The Casa Gótica, located behind the Town Hall, is a particularly valuable 15th-century example of Gothic civil architecture.

What unique natural areas or viewpoints are there?

The Río Saja valley itself provides a picturesque setting, protected by surrounding mountains like Ibio and Mozagro. For a unique perspective, walk across the Pasarela sobre el Río Saja, a wooden walkway exclusively for pedestrians and cyclists, connecting different natural paths.

Are there any hidden gems or lesser-known spots in Mazcuerras?

Consider visiting Viveros Escalante, historic nurseries over a century old, nationally recognized for their cultivation of trees and plants. This contributes to Mazcuerras's reputation as "the town of flowers." The Molino, an 18th-century mill along the Saja River, also offers a glimpse into the region's historical importance of milling.
